Details
- Venhill brake lines, clutch lines and line lenghts use smooth bore DuPont Teflon hose for better heat resistance.
- Marine grade stainless braiding eliminates expansion so that all the braking force is transmitted to the brake.
- Corrosion-free 303 stainless steel swivel unions allow perfect twist-free alignment.
- Dome-head banjo bolts for clean look and work easier on cramped modern machines.
- PVC jacket from a range of colours protects the braided hose and paintwork
- When needed off road lines have a nylon rigid sleeving to clamp the hose on fork legs or swing arm.
- End fittings supplied in high quality chrome with copper washers (Off road lines).
- End fittings available in stainless steel, high quality chrome, or black finish (Road).
- Re-use existing bolts or purchase banjo bolts separately.
- All brake line kits include banjo bolts with copper washers and installation guide. These items are not shipped with simple Powerhose plus line lengths.
- Every Venhill hose is built to meet or exceed DOT and TUV requirements. Every line is gas pressure tested to 1500 PSI.
- Powerhose plus brake lines are avaliable in a variety of colours and lengths between 100mm and 5200mm in 25mm increments.
